There were four of us staying here for GT graduation. Checking in and out was easy, parking was fine, and communication with the host was good. The location was good for walking to campus so we didn't have to contend with parking. Also 15-20 minutes to restaurants in Atlantic Station or to get to Midtown (Whole Foods/Publix). As far as the house, it was generally clean and all appliances worked. We had enough dishes for cooking and eating, etc. Beds were nice. No kitchen towels or bathmats, however. The rooms have closets but no dressers. There are folding tables in the closets that can be set up. It's an older property that's showing some age, which is normal for original Home Park houses. The doorknob on one of the bedrooms kept falling off. We noticed a new one in a drawer in the kitchen, so perhaps the next guests will benefit from that. They had ordered new cornhole games, but these were still in the cardboard box they were delivered in and we didn't have time to put them together and didn't want the responsibility in case they were damaged during shipping--again, maybe the next guest will benefit. The outdoor cushions are showing their age, porch floor and walls are OK but need a good pressure wash. We pulled a pan out of the cabinet only to discover the last guest's eggs still encrusted on it. No bueno. Thankfully that was the only dirty dish. Otherwise, the house sufficed for what we needed over the weekend, but we probably won't stay here again.

The outdoor space was the reason we booked here. The horseshoe pit is small but fun. One of the shoes were missing. The cornhole was fun, itâs small travel size boards and the space where they are is uneven. But we arenât there for tournaments. Just fun with the kids. The fire pit is fine. No firewood, they just leave a few âduraflameâ type logs. But itâs more for effect and to help keep bugs away. BBQ was old, rusty and dirty.
We had a group of six and it was tight. The listing says up to eight, definitely not. One small bathroom. The bedrooms are small and have just a bed. So plan on your clothes and suitcases being on the floor. The beds were comfortable, linens were nice quality.
The light in the dining area did not work, we even tried a different bulb, the room with the bunk beds has no light either. Bring a sleep mask though as the shades arenât room darkening. Very bright once the sun comes up.
Nice neighborhood which seems to be an up and coming âmore upscaleâ. Lots of renovations goin on.
I reached out to the owner via vrbo message, phone call and text a week ahead of time with a few questions and he never replied. That didnât give an easy feeling a week ahead of the trip.
All in all it was a good stay. Iâd give it an overall 3.5 Probably will not stay here again.
